HPC Hardware Service Engineer, Irvine, CA, On-site
Hewlett Packard Enterprise is the global edge-to-cloud company advancing the way people live and work. In this role, you will support HPC Systems at a mission-critical customer's site, engaging in technical problem solving and maintaining high-performance computing systems. Responsibilities include troubleshooting hardware issues, managing service tickets, and collaborating with team members and customers to ensure timely resolution of problems.

Responsibilities
Report daily to, and physically work at, the Customer’s Site
Engage in technical problem solving across multiple technologies
Creates and owns service tickets, via Salesforce, updates and drives the case through closure
Identifies, analyzes, diagnoses, troubleshoots and repairs hardware issues with focus on responsiveness and communication
Gather data, perform analysis, and escalate cases to higher-level product support groups, to ensure timely resolution of system or customer issues
Responsible for verifying and implementing detailed technical solutions to problems
Maintains ongoing log documenting issues and resolutions, for tracking and monthly discussion
Participate as part of a team and maintain a good relationship with team members and customers
Owns and produces customer documentation
Occasional travel for training is required
Qualification
Required
US Citizenship required
5+ years of professional experience and a Bachelor of Arts/Science or equivalent degree in computer science or related area of study; without a degree, three additional years of relevant professional experience (8+ years in total)
Experience installing, troubleshooting and supporting enterprise-level servers, storage, and networking equipment
Experience working in large-scale data center environments and/or High Performance Computing (HPC)
Experience with Linux based OS, hardware troubleshooting and diagnostics
Must be a self-starter who is able to work independently, without supervision, and within a team environment
Strong problem solving and self-management skills with attention to detail
Possesses an understanding of architectural dependencies of technologies
Ability to work in a multi-technology environment, with the ability to diagnose complex technical problems to their root cause
Ability to communicate broad and specific concepts with team members and peers
Ability to prioritize tasks and effectively communicate verbally and in writing
Role models Knowledge sharing and re-use within practice or profession
Strong desire to learn and improve
